Ten Tonnes - Ten Tonnes

The Guardian 60

(Warner Bros)

Ah, the curse of the younger sibling, invariably discussed in relation to their more famous relations. Ten Tonnes – Ethan Barnett, 22, the younger brother of George Ezra – is no Solange, the cooler, artier, more plugged-in of the two Knowles sisters, who heavily influenced Beyoncé’s aesthetic.

Still, you can insert a cigarette paper or two between these Hertfordshire tunesmiths. Ten Tonnes’ songs – like Better Than Me or Give – may be breezy guitar singalongs, but they are a smidge less Jack Wills and a tad more Kooks than George Ezra’s. Co-production and co-songwriting credits on this tuneful debut album go to an ex-Maccabee (Hugo White), Nick Hodgson (Kaiser Chiefs’ songwriter), Crispin Hunt (former Longpig) and others, proving 90s and 00s indie rock survivors can carve out a second life for themselves.
